A second-degree polynomial takes the form
\(f(x) = ax^2 + bx + c\)
for some constants a, b, and c. Such a function is continuous and differentiable everywhere in its domain.
Differentiating f(x) with respect to x gives
\(\dfrac{df}{dx} = 2ax + b\)
We're told that
• f(x) is increasing on [0, 8]
• f(x) is decreasing on ]-10, 0]
and since df/dx is continuous, this tells us that df/dx = 0 when x = 0. It follows that b = 0, and we can write
\(f(x) = ax^2 + c\)
We're also given that the curve passes through the point (-8, 4), which gives rise to the constraint
\(f(-8) = 64a - 8b + c = 4 \implies 64a + c = 4\)
Since f(x) is decreasing on ]-10, 0], we have df/dx < 0 when x = -8, so
\(2ax+b < 0 \implies -16a < 0 \implies a > 0\)
This means f(x) is minimized when x = 0, with min{f(x)} = c, so the co-domain of f(x) is the set {f(x) ∈ ℝ : f(x) ≥ c}.
Without another condition, that's all we can say about the co-domain. There are infinitely many choices for the constants a and c that satisfy the given conditions. For example,
a = 1, c = -60 ⇒ f(x) = x² - 60 ⇒ f(-8) = 4
⇒ co-domain = {f(x) ∈ ℝ : f(x) ≥ -60}
a = 2, c = -124 ⇒ f(x) = 2x² - 124 ⇒ f(-8) = 4
⇒ co-domain = {f(x) ∈ ℝ : f(x) ≥ -124}
etc.

The sum of two numbers is 998
The difference between them is 10
What are the two numbers?
Answer:
The two numbers are 494 and 504
Step-by-step explanation:
Let x = one of the numbers
Let y = the other number
x + y = 998
x - y = 10 or x = y + 10
Substitute y + 10 for x in the first equation and solve for y
x + y = 998
y + 10 + y = 998 Subtract 10 from both sides
y + y = 988 Combine like terms
2y = 988 Divide both sides by 2
y = 494
One of the numbers is 494.
x = y + 10 Substitute 494 for y
x = 494 + 10
x = 504
The other number is 504.
Check:
x + y = 998
504 + 494 = 998
998 = 998 checks
x - y = 10
504 - 494 = 10
10 = 10 checks

A theater group made appearances in two cities. The hotel charge before tax in the second city was $1500 higher than in the first. The tax in the first city was 7.5%, and the tax in the second city was 5%. The total hotel tax paid for the two cities was $825. How much was the hotel charge in each city before tax?
The hotel charge in the first city before tax was $6000 and the hotel charge in the second city before tax was $7500.
Let x be the hotel charge before tax in the first city, and y be the hotel charge before tax in the second city. Then we have:
y = x + 1500 (the hotel charge before tax in the second city was $1500 higher than in the first)
0.075x + 0.05y = 825 (the total hotel tax paid for the two cities was $825)
We can use the first equation to solve for y in terms of x:
y = x + 1500
Then we can substitute this expression for y into the second equation:
0.075x + 0.05(x + 1500) = 825
Simplifying this equation, we get:
0.075x + 0.05x + 75 = 825
0.125x = 750
x = 6000
So the hotel charge before tax in the first city was $6000. Using the first equation, we can find the hotel charge before tax in the second city:
y = x + 1500
y = 6000 + 1500
y = 7500
So the hotel charge before tax in the second city was $7500.
Therefore, the answer is: The hotel charge in the first city before tax was $6000 and the hotel charge in the second city before tax was $7500.

Explain the difference between linear, exponential, and quadratic functions in terms of their graphs, their patterns, and their rates of change.
Answer:
Quadratic functions are those where their rate of change changes at a constant rate. Exponential functions are those where their rate of change is proportional to itself.
An example of a quadratic function would be the shape that a ball makes when you throw it. Gravity causes a constant acceleration, the ball slows down as it is moving up, and then it speeds up as it comes down.
An example of an exponential function would be the population of a bacterium as long as there is enough space and nutrients or how your money grows with compound interest in a bank.
A quadratic function is one in the form
f(x)=ax2+bx+c
It’s rate of change (first derivative) is linear.
f′(x)=2ax+b
The rate of the rate of change (second derivative) is constant.
f′′(x)=2a
Quadratics are then the solutions to the differential equation
f′′=C
An exponential function is one in the following form.
g(x)=Aekx
It’s rate of change is another exponential function.
g′(x)=Akekx
So exponentials are the solutions to the differential equation
g′=kg

The fοrmula tο find the area and perimeter οf a twο-dimensiοnal shape depends οn the type οf shape. Here are sοme cοmmοn fοrmulas:
1. Rectangle:
• Area: A = length x width
• Perimeter: P = 2(length + width)
2. Square:
• Area: A = side x side (οr A = side²)
• Perimeter: P = 4 x side
3. Circle:
• Area: A = π x radius²
• Circumference (perimeter): C = 2π x radius (οr C = π x diameter)
4. Triangle:
• Area: A = (base x height) / 2
• Perimeter: P = side1 + side2 + side3
5. Trapezοid:
• Area: A = ((base1 + base2) x height) / 2
• Perimeter: P = side1 + side2 + side3 + side4
